Product Description:
The EJ9400 is an I/O power expansion module produced by Beckhoff for the EJ EtherCAT Plugins series. It slots beside other plug-in cards on a machine-mounted carrier board and supplies power to the local EtherCAT E-Bus, allowing downstream electronics to remain energized without additional external wiring. The module expands the available power budget for additional digital or analog slices while preserving the compact form factor required in modular industrial automation assemblies. Its plug-in design also reduces the amount of point-to-point power wiring required across a densely populated control node.
The card stabilizes the internal bus at 3.3 V and can supply up to 2.5 A, helping offset voltage drops when multiple high-draw channels are present. Because the auxiliary supply is generated in a SELV/PELV circuit, the additional energy maintains the same touch-safe classification as the primary coupler feed. The EJ9400 is installed after the coupler, allowing it to reinforce the power supply for every module that follows it on the backplane. It serves as an additional E-Bus supply and does not modify process data exchanged by the connected I/O modules. The EtherCAT master can still recognize the module through standard device identification, even though its primary function is local power expansion.
The E-Bus reference is tied to a common ground, so every connected slice shares a unified return path that helps minimize differential noise between neighboring channels. When an application uses two or more network segments with local power separation, multiple EJ9400 units can be cascaded to keep each segment within its rated current. A carrier board may use an optional reset contact to discharge the energy store during maintenance and shorten restart times after a fault has been cleared.
